ABSTRACT:
A method of making refractory carbide particles, which method comprises heating a granule containing refractory metal and carbon to a sufficient temperature to form a molten droplet of refractory carbide, carbon being included in said droplet in excess of the stoichiometric amount which combines with the refractory metal in the highest usual valence thereof, and cooling said molten droplet below the eutectic temperature within 60 seconds or less to cause a thin continuous layer of highly crystalline carbon to precipitate out on the outer surface thereof.
